Yellow duck debugging software

Rest assured your account information is safe because yellow duck doesnt store your instagram login information. The following are debugging software on the market today. Cyberduck is based on work by joseph weizenbaum and norbert landsteiner. In the story, a programmer would debug code by explaining it, line by line, to a yellow plastic waterfowl. Tara mayberry teaberry creative here are some of the important lessons i have learned from using rubber duck debugging during my website development work. Thats why companies like gunnar started making computer glasses that have yellowtinted. Rubber duck debugging is actually a reference to a story in the book the pragmatic programmer a programmer has a literal rubber duck and debugs code by making himself talk to the duck and as he goes through his code line by line. Release the quackin tshirt funny yellow rubber duck.

The name is a reference to a story in the book the pragmatic programmer in. Run yellow duck and exercise the application in any case, it may also ask for additional software installations that you need to make. The name is a reference to a story in the book the pragmatic programmer in which a programmer would carry around a rubber duck and debug their code by forcing themselves to explain it, linebyline, to the duck. Whats hard about programming for a beginner isnt really big hard esoteric. Yellow rubber duck stickers featuring millions of original designs created by independent artists. The other person should look over your shoulder at the screen, and nod his or her head constantly like a rubber duck bobbing up and down in a bathtub. Ruth john, coding artist, shares her one weird trick on how to debug a problem by using an emotional support item.

Rubber duck debugging problem solving by talking to yourself. Place rubber duck on desk and inform it you are just going to go over some code with it, if. Why rubber duck debugging is the best way to debug your code how is it possible that a rubber duck could be the most useful debugging tool youll ever use. The purpose of this app is to let you get to know us, the contest, our app, and other fine details.

An object oriented framework that will help you with creating php web applications. In order to debug their code programmers sometimes try to explain it to a rubber duck. Its a method of debugging code that involves the classic bathroom toy. A user of a program, who does not have the knowledge of how to fix the problem, can learn enough about the problem so that he will avoid it until it is permanently fixed. Have you ever had a eureka moment while explaining something to someone. Seems kinda deliberate, since most rubber ducks ive seen, if not all, are actually yellow. Newest quackoverflow questions meta stack exchange. Rubber duck debugging rdd is a scientifically valid and a proven technique used in the field of software engineering to help detect errors in program code. In the world of software engineering, a rubber duck method helps to debug codes. Rubber duck debugging programmers best friend funny coder tshirt. Rubber duck stickers featuring millions of original designs created by independent artists. Hipster monocule as yellow rubber duck shirt for adult. Eliza a computer program for the study of natural language communication between man and machine. Live stream on instagram from your computer yellow duck.

It helps you to find bugs and problems in your code. Decorate your laptops, water bottles, notebooks and windows. Rubber duck debugging is a problemsolving method used by software engineers and programmers to debug code. Rubber ducking is the shortened term for rubber duck debugging.

Why rubber duck debugging is the best way to debug your code. Essentially, rubber ducking is about talking through your coding problems with a friendly duck that wont judge you. That is, when you set out to ask a question, you should describe whats happening in sufficient detail that we can follow along. How to use yellow duck on windows help center yellow. How a rubber duck taught me to be a better programmer. By definition, rubber ducking is short form for rubber duck debugging and is simply a method of debugging code. Free, secure and fast windows debuggers software downloads from the largest open source applications and software directory. In it, the slang term rubber duck debugging has been created to describe an often effective yet simple strategy for debugging code. Why rubber ducking is one of your greatest resources as a. Keep in mind, it does not support 2step authentication. In software engineering, rubber duck debugging is a method of debugging code.

Again, not the sellers fault, or the maker of the duck. Bug and debugging are attributed to the discovery of a moth found in a mark ii computer at harvard university. Debugging finding and solving problems in software 2. Btw did anyone consider this might be offensive to a certain president, on account of a prominent duck by the name of donald and the duck being orange and all. Code2015 was a 48hour hackathon thanks to xmg and the government of canada. Beg, borrow, steal, buy, fabricate or otherwise obtain a rubber. Many other terms exist for this technique, often involving different usually inanimate objects like pets. Compare the best free open source windows debuggers software at sourceforge. Despite the silly nameand initially bizarre concept rubber duck debugging is a popular, wellestablished programming practice. In software engineering especially xp there is a commonly held belief that talking to a rubber duck will improve performance when debugging problematic code. How to stream live on instagram from a pc or mac yellow. Install both software open yellow duck, it will take some time to download some files needed. Rubber duck debugging rubber duck debugging debugging.

The reason we so love rubber duck debugging is that typically in the process of doing this, youll find your problem. It features advanced options such as form validation, an objectrelation mapper, image handling, and way more. Also known as the duck test, it aids in debugging a program when it does not perform as expected. Heres an example of how rubber duck debugging might be used to solve our original video game display issue. Inspired designs on tshirts, posters, stickers, home decor, and more by independent artists and designers from around the world. In rubber duck debugging, the programmer sits a small rubber duck or other inanimate object near them on a desk or near a computer, and explains the code to the duck line by line. It is especially useful for those who are new to programming as it assists in rapid learning and problem solving. For several months greg carried around a small yellow rubber duck, which hed place on his terminal while coding. The strace project has been moved to strace is a diagnostic, debugging and instructional userspace tracer for linux.

What my rubber duck has taught me my rubber duck, the green ninja image credit. Anyone whos first learning to program understands this well. In the story, a programmer would debug code by explaining it, line by line, to a yellow. Well, the duck in that one apparently so annoyed one of our guest critters that the duck got bitten a couple of times. Use instagram live from any platform of your choice because yellow duck adds desktop platforms to the mix stream to instagram using obs.

Beg, borrow, steal, buy, fabricate or otherwise obtain a rubber duck bathtub variety. Stumped, you turn to the only one who understands you and pour your heart out to a little yellow rubber duck. At stack exchange, we insist that people who ask questions put some effort into their question, and were kind of jerks about it. I was very pleased to find the addition of a yellow duck to the stack overflow pages, that promised to help. So, it took on water, and after a while it just couldnt float well. All orders are custom made and most ship worldwide within 24 hours. Place rubber duck on desk and inform it you are just going to go over some code with it, if thats all right. What it is, and why you should always steer clear of programmers sitting at their desk talking to rubber ducks or other little toys.

1146 792 1120 1343 517 1419 1464 186 1207 33 747 150 693 292 373 1065 467 950 1197 1551 774 214 1468 1405 44 1375 85 732 662 899 626 208 668 1348 1204 769 1336